内网DNS查询外网DNS的解决方案

在内网环境中,由于安全性和资源管理的需求,通常会设置内网DNS服务器,用于解析内网域名,在某些情况下,我们需要查询外网DNS服务器的信息,以便获取更准确的解析结果,本文将介绍几种内网DNS查询外网DNS的方法。
直接查询外网DNS
配置内网DNS服务器
需要在内网DNS服务器上添加外网DNS服务器的IP地址,以下是在Windows系统中配置DNS服务器的步骤:
(1)打开“控制面板”,选择“网络和共享中心”。
(2)点击左侧的“更改适配器设置”。
(3)右键点击要配置的适配器,选择“属性”。
(4)双击“Internet协议版本4(TCP/IPv4)”。
(5)在“使用下面的DNS服务器地址”栏中,输入外网DNS服务器的IP地址。
设置DNS服务器优先级
为了确保内网DNS服务器首先尝试解析内网域名,可以设置DNS服务器的优先级,以下是在Windows系统中设置DNS服务器优先级的步骤:
(1)在DNS服务器配置界面中,找到“DNS服务器”选项。
(2)选中内网DNS服务器的IP地址,点击“属性”。
(3)在“DNS服务器优先级”栏中,将内网DNS服务器的优先级设置为比外网DNS服务器低。

使用代理服务器查询外网DNS
设置代理服务器
在Windows系统中,可以通过以下步骤设置代理服务器:
(1)打开“控制面板”,选择“网络和共享中心”。
(2)点击左侧的“更改适配器设置”。
(3)右键点击要配置的适配器,选择“属性”。
(4)双击“Internet协议版本4(TCP/IPv4)”。
(5)在“使用下面的代理服务器地址”栏中,输入代理服务器的IP地址和端口号。
使用代理服务器查询外网DNS
设置代理服务器后,内网DNS服务器会通过代理服务器查询外网DNS,这样,内网设备可以绕过内网DNS服务器的限制,直接访问外网DNS服务器。
使用本地DNS缓存查询外网DNS
启用本地DNS缓存
在Windows系统中,可以通过以下步骤启用本地DNS缓存:
(1)打开“控制面板”,选择“网络和共享中心”。

(2)点击左侧的“更改适配器设置”。
(3)右键点击要配置的适配器,选择“属性”。
(4)双击“Internet协议版本4(TCP/IPv4)”。
(5)勾选“使用本地DNS缓存”复选框。
使用本地DNS缓存查询外网DNS
启用本地DNS缓存后,内网DNS服务器会将查询结果缓存一段时间,当再次查询同一域名时,可以直接从缓存中获取结果,从而提高查询效率。
FAQs
问:内网DNS查询外网DNS有哪些优势?
答:内网DNS查询外网DNS可以确保解析结果的准确性,提高查询效率,并减少内网DNS服务器的负担。
问:如何判断内网DNS查询外网DNS成功?
答:如果查询结果显示外网DNS服务器的IP地址,则表示内网DNS查询外网DNS成功。
来源互联网整合,作者:小编,如若转载,请注明出处:https://www.aiboce.com/ask/330119.html